Engy Ali is a scholar working on Infectious Diseases, General Health Professions and Nutrition and Dietetics. According to data from OpenAlex, Engy Ali has authored 42 papers receiving a total of 603 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Infectious Diseases, 11 papers in General Health Professions and 10 papers in Nutrition and Dietetics. Recurrent topics in Engy Ali's work include Child Nutrition and Water Access (10 papers), Migration, Health and Trauma (7 papers) and Tuberculosis Research and Epidemiology (7 papers). Engy Ali is often cited by papers focused on Child Nutrition and Water Access (10 papers), Migration, Health and Trauma (7 papers) and Tuberculosis Research and Epidemiology (7 papers). Engy Ali collaborates with scholars based in Luxembourg, Belgium and France. Engy Ali's co-authors include Anthony Harries, Rony Zachariah, Katie Tayler‐Smith, Rafaël Van den Bergh, Emilie Venables, S. Adè, Srinath Satyanarayana, Marcel Manzi, Sven Gudmund Hinderaker and K. Tayler‐Smith and has published in prestigious journals such as SHILAP Revista de lepidopterología, PLoS ONE and Social Science & Medicine.
